很奇怪,前天放工時電腦借給同事使用後,幾乎所有圖示都消失了,只剩下一個個藍白色的Icon,即是沒有圖示時那個預設圖標喇。 今天上班才有空去找資料,原來是 IconCache.db 這個檔案損毀了,將其刪除讓 Windows XP 自動重建即可,方法如下:
1) 發生如下圖所示的問題,無法顯示正確的 Icon:
2) 先打開 "我的電腦",到 "工具" ==> "資料夾選項" ==> "檢視" ==> 選取 "顯示所有檔案和資料夾" 及 取消 "隱藏已知檔案類型的副檔名" 。
3) 接下來,到 "C:\Documents and Settings\[USER_NAME]\Local Settings\Application Data" , [USER_NAME] 為你的名稱。
4) 應該會看到一個名叫 "IconCache.db" 的檔案,將其重新命名為 "IconCache.bak.db" ,其實將整個檔案刪除亦可,除你喜歡,反正這個檔案都沒用了,不過我通常都會先保存下來,稍後證實系統正常後才會完全刪除。
5) 更名後,重新啟動電腦。
6) 確認圖示回後正常後,便可將剛才的 "IconCache.bak.db" 刪除了。
這個方法亦適用於大部份的圖示問題,例如XP顯示錯誤的Icon : 明明是一個網頁檔案,卻顯示了圖片的Icon。
希望這資料對大家有用吧。